Minsait

Senior Data Engineer – Specialist

Minsait

full-time

Posted on:

Location Type: Hybrid

Location: São PauloBrazil

Visit company website

Explore more

AI Apply
Apply

Job Level

About the role

  • Develop and maintain batch data pipelines using PySpark (SQL-focused)
  • Write and optimize complex SQL queries to support business logic and reporting needs
  • Independently understand requirements and translate them into code
  • Transform and integrate data from various sources into Iceberg tables and Snowflake
  • Contribute to the development of data marts and organized datasets for business consumption
  • Collaborate with business analysts to understand data requirements
  • Monitor and manage data jobs running on AWS EMR, orchestrated by Airflow, using S3, Glue and other AWS services
  • Ensure data quality, consistency and performance across the pipeline

Requirements

  • Fluency in English is mandatory
  • Minimum of 10 years of hands-on experience in data engineering, writing complex SQL queries
  • Proven expertise in SQL including joins, aggregations, window functions and performance optimization
  • Hands-on experience with PySpark, especially Spark SQL
  • Familiarity with AWS data services (e.g., EMR, S3, Glue)
  • Understanding of data modeling frameworks, including the Kimball methodology
  • Experience working with Snowflake or similar cloud data warehouses
  • Knowledge of Apache Iceberg or similar table formats (e.g., Delta Lake, Hudi)
  • Experience building and managing data marts
  • Familiarity with Airflow or other orchestration tools
  • Familiarity with infrastructure-as-code tools such as Terraform
  • Understanding of ODS (Operational Data Store) patterns and data lake architecture
  • Experience with Bitbucket (or any similar git tool)
  • Experience/understanding of Jenkins
Benefits
  • Company-subsidized health plan for the employee
  • Option to include dependents in the health plan with payroll deduction
  • Dental assistance (optional)
  • Option to include dependents in the dental assistance plan with payroll deduction
  • Meal voucher or food allowance
  • Transportation voucher (optional)
  • Impact & Care - Personal Guidance Program providing confidential emotional and counseling support in psychological, legal, financial, social and pet-related areas at no cost for the employee and legal dependents
  • Gympass - Wellhub (access to over 700 gyms across Brazil with plans starting at R$ 29.90 via payroll deduction)
  • Option to include dependents in Gympass - Wellhub (up to 3 dependents - paid via credit card)
  • Access to Udemy through our intranet
  • Partnerships with major consumer brands
  • Partnership with SESC for employee and dependents
  • Discount agreements with educational institutions (undergraduate and postgraduate) and language schools/certification bodies
  • Group life insurance
Applicant Tracking System Keywords

Tip: use these terms in your resume and cover letter to boost ATS matches.

Hard Skills & Tools
PySparkSQLdata engineeringdata modelingperformance optimizationdata transformationdata integrationdata martsdata qualitydata pipeline
Soft Skills
collaborationindependencecommunicationproblem-solvinganalytical thinking